加入收藏 | 设为首页 | 会员中心 | 我要投稿 91站长网 (https://www.91zhanzhang.com.cn/)- 混合云存储、媒体处理、应用安全、安全管理、数据分析!
当前位置: 首页 > 服务器 > 系统 > 正文

深度学习系统容器化部署与编排优化实践

发布时间:2026-03-04 13:34:18 所属栏目:系统 来源:DaWei
导读:  深度学习系统容器化部署是现代机器学习工程中的关键步骤,它通过将模型、依赖库和配置打包到一个轻量级的容器中,确保了环境的一致性和可移植性。容器化技术如Docker,使得开发、测试和生产环境能够保持高度一致

  深度学习系统容器化部署是现代机器学习工程中的关键步骤,它通过将模型、依赖库和配置打包到一个轻量级的容器中,确保了环境的一致性和可移植性。容器化技术如Docker,使得开发、测试和生产环境能够保持高度一致,减少了因环境差异导致的问题。


AI生成内容图,仅供参考

  在实际应用中,容器化不仅简化了部署流程,还提高了系统的可扩展性。例如,使用Docker镜像可以快速构建和部署多个实例,满足高并发或分布式训练的需求。同时,容器化的特性也使得版本控制和回滚变得更加高效,避免了传统部署方式中常见的“依赖地狱”问题。


  除了容器化,编排工具如Kubernetes在深度学习系统中发挥着重要作用。Kubernetes能够自动管理容器的生命周期,实现负载均衡、自动扩缩容以及故障恢复等功能。这为大规模深度学习任务提供了稳定的运行环境,特别是在处理大量数据和复杂模型时,能够显著提升资源利用率。


  优化容器镜像也是提升性能的关键环节。通过精简基础镜像、合并安装步骤以及移除不必要的文件,可以有效减少镜像体积,加快拉取和启动速度。合理设置资源限制和调度策略,有助于避免资源争用,确保每个任务都能获得所需的计算资源。


  在实际操作中,结合CI/CD流程进行自动化部署,可以进一步提升效率和可靠性。通过持续集成和持续交付,每次代码变更都可以触发自动构建和测试,确保新版本的稳定性。同时,监控和日志系统也应与容器化部署紧密结合,以便及时发现和解决问题。

(编辑:91站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章